Merhaba
Bugün centos işletim sistemine sahip sunucunuza lighttpd’nin ürettiği php cache yazılımı xcache kurulumunu anlatacağım.
Kurulum tüm kontrol panelleri için geçerlidir.
Xcache dosyalarını çekeceğimiz dizine geçip, xcache 2.0.0 versiyonunu sunucumuza wget ile çekiyoruz.
cd /usr/local/src
wget http://xcache.lighttpd.net/pub/Releases/2.0.0/xcache-2.0.0.tar.gz
Ardından indirdiğimiz tar.gz dosyayı sıkışmış halden kurtarıyoruz.
tar -zxf xcache-2.0.0.tar.gz
Dosyalarımızı kullanılabilir hale getirdikten sonra açılmış dosyamıza giriyoruz ve xcache dosyalarını derliyoruz.
cd xcache-2.0.0
phpize
./configure –enable-xcache
Son aşamada derlenmiş xcache dosyalarımıza make ve make install çekerek kurulumu tamamlıyoruz.
make
su
make install
Xcache kurulu durumda ancak webserver tarafının xcache’i görmesi gerekiyor. Bunun için php.ini dosyamızı açıyoruz.
(Default php.ini yolu /usr/local/lib/php.ini)
nano /usr/local/lib/php.ini
Php.ini içinde kesin bir yeri olmamakla beraber herhangi boş satıra xcache.so satrını ekleyebilirsiniz.
PHP 5.2.x versiyonları için
zend_extension=/usr/local/lib/php/extensions/no-debug-non-zts-20060613/xcache.so
xcache.size=128M
PHP 5.3.x versiyonları için
zend_extension=/usr/local/lib/php/extensions/no-debug-non-zts-20090626/xcache.so
xcache.size=128M
Xcache.size satırı xcache’in kullanacağı maksimum bellek miktarını belirler, sunucu belleğine göre uygun bir değer belirleyebilirsiniz.
İlgili satırları ekledikten sonra ctrl-x, y, enter ile dosyamızı kaydediyoruz. Ardından web sunucumuzu restartlıyoruz.
service httpd restart
Litespeed kullananlar için
service lsws restart
Kurulum başarılı olarak bittiyse php -v komutu verdiğinizde bileşenler arasında xcache görünür halde olacaktır.
Önemli Not: Eğer cpanelde easyapache kullanarak php derleme yaparken xcache seçtiyseniz, xcache kurulumundan sonra php.ini den, xcache.so satırını mutlaka siliniz aksi taktirde Segmentation fault hatası alırsınız.
Xcache istatistiklerine ulaşmak
Xcache istatistiklerini takip etmek isterseniz, sunucuya çektiğiniz xcache dosyaları içerisinden admin panel dosyalarını sitenizin ftp sine aktarıp, php.ini xcache satırının altına aşağıdaki kodları ekleyebilirsiniz.
xcache.admin.user = “xcachecp”
xcache.admin.pass = “e10adc3949ba59abbe56e057f20f883e”
Yukardaki satırlara göre xcache admin panel kullanıcı adı xcachecp dir. Admin.pass kısmı md5 şifreli haldedir, bu md5 ile şifre 123456 olmaktadır, md5 şifre oluşturma sitelerinden belirlediğiniz şifrenin md5 kodunu oluşturup admin.pass satırındaki tırnaklı kısımlar arasında md5 kodunu yapıştırabilirsiniz.
Anlatım: Elazığlı168
blog.ozkula.com.tr ve sunucuoptimizasyon.com kaynak gösterilerek alıntı yapılabilir.
İlginizi Çekebilir
Günümüzde dijital dünyada fark yaratmak isteyen her işletme için güçlü bir web varlığı olmazsa olmaz. Bu bağlamda, Windows...
Devamını OkuGünümüzde siber güvenlik, dijital yaşamımızın vazgeçilmez bir parçası haline gelmiştir. Özellikle fidye yazılımlar, bireylerin ve şirketlerin verilerini rehin...
Devamını OkuBlog yazınızda, özgün başlık seçiminden profesyonel görsel kullanıma kadar etkili SEO stratejilerini ve kullanıcı deneyimini nasıl iyileştireceğinizi keşfedin.E-ticaret...
Devamını OkuMuhasebe süreçlerinin güvenliği, veri bütünlüğü ve sürekliliği, işletmeler için olmazsa olmaz kriterler arasındadır. Bu nedenle, muhasebe verilerinizi yönetirken...
Devamını OkuWeb siteniz için en iyi hosting firmasını seçerken dikkat etmeniz gereken konuları öğrenin: kontrol paneli, müşteri desteği, fiyatlandırma...
Devamını OkuGoogle Analytics'in ne olduğunu, nasıl kurulacağını, veri analizi ve raporlama araçlarını anlatan detaylı rehber. Veri inceleme ipuçları.Blog Giriş...
Devamını Oku